@click.command()
@click.argument("root_path", type=click.Path(exists=True))
@click.argument("destination_path", type=click.Path())
# general options
@click.option("--verbose", "-v", default=False, is_flag=True, help="Verbose output")
@click.option(
"--no_directory_hashes",
"-n",
default=False,
is_flag=True,
help="Skip creation of directory hashes, only reference directories without hash",
)
@click.option("ignore_list", "--ignore", "-i", multiple=True, help="A single file pattern to ignore.")
@click.option(
"ignore_spec_file",
"--ignore_spec",
"-ii",
type=click.Path(exists=True),
help="A file containing multiple file patterns to ignore.",
)
def flatten(root_path, destination_path, verbose, no_directory_hashes, ignore_list, ignore_spec_file):
"""
Flatten an MHL history into one external manifest
\b
The flatten command iterates through the mhl-history, collects all known files and
their hashes in multiple hash formats and writes them to a new mhl file outside of the
iterated history.
"""
flatten_history(root_path, destination_path, verbose, no_directory_hashes, ignore_list, ignore_spec_file)
return


def flatten_history(root_path, destination_path, verbose, no_directory_hashes, ignore_list=None, ignore_spec_file=None):
logger.verbose_logging = verbose

if not os.path.isabs(root_path):
root_path = os.path.join(os.getcwd(), root_path)

logger.verbose(f"Flattening folder at path: {root_path} ...")

existing_history = MHLHistory.load_from_path(root_path)

# create the ignore specification
ignore_spec = ignore.MHLIgnoreSpec(existing_history.latest_ignore_patterns(), ignore_list, ignore_spec_file)

# start a verification session on the existing history
collection_history = MHLHistory.create_collection_at_path(destination_path)
session = MHLGenerationCreationSession(collection_history, ignore_spec)

# store the directory hashes of sub folders so we can use it when calculating the hash of the parent folder
dir_hash_mappings = {}

if len(existing_history.hash_lists) == 0:
raise errors.NoMHLHistoryException(root_path)

for hash_list in existing_history.hash_lists:
for media_hash in hash_list.media_hashes:
if not media_hash.is_directory:
for hash_entry in media_hash.hash_entries:
if hash_entry.action != "failed":
# check if this entry is newer than the one already in there to avoid duplicate entries
found_media_hash = session.new_hash_lists[collection_history].find_media_hash_for_path(
media_hash.path
)
if found_media_hash == None:
session.append_file_hash(
media_hash.path,
media_hash.file_size,
media_hash.last_modification_date,
hash_entry.hash_format,
hash_entry.hash_string,
action=hash_entry.action,
hash_date=hash_entry.hash_date,
)
else:
hashformat_is_already_there = False
for found_hash_entry in found_media_hash.hash_entries:
if found_hash_entry.hash_format == hash_entry.hash_format:
hashformat_is_already_there = True
if not hashformat_is_already_there:
# assuming that hash_entry of same type also has same hash_value ..
session.append_file_hash(
media_hash.path,
media_hash.file_size,
media_hash.last_modification_date,
hash_entry.hash_format,
hash_entry.hash_string,
action=hash_entry.action,
)

commit_session_for_collection(session, root_path)
